Traveling at 1 mph, my 2011 Infiniti Qx56 bumped another vehicle. There was no damage to either vehicle, but my driver airbag deployed. Infiniti is refusing to look at the vehicle unless my insurance company asks them to. I feel this low speed deployment is from a defect in this week old vehicle, but cannot get help. I am concerned Infiniti is attempting to ignore the problem and brush it under the rug.

The battery constantly goes dead in the car. I bought a new infinity battery in the car the same thing happened. You can reproduce this problem by sitting in the car listening to the radio for 30 minutes. I was sitting in the car listening radio and the car battery went dead and the car shut off. This is a huge issue, the Qx56 is a 8 cylinder car. It does not charge very easily. I have to carry a battery charger in my car. I have been stranded several times in the last year. I have taken the car to infinity and they claim nothing is wrong with the car. Since it is a big car the battery drain quickly.
